云原生

Docker 部署 PostgreSQL 数据库

Docker 部署 PostgreSQL 数据库 基于 Docker 部署 PostgreSQL 数据库 一、拉取 PostgreSQL 镜像 二、运行 PostgreSQL 容器 三、运行命令参数详解 四、查看容器运行状态 基于 Docker 部署 PostgreSQL 数据库 一、拉取 PostgreSQL 镜像首先,确保你的 Docker 环境已正

【Docker基础】Docker容器管理:docker exec详解

目录1 docker exec命令概述1.1 命令定位与作用1.2 与相似命令对比2 基本语法与参数解析2.1 完整命令语法2.2 核心参数详解2.2.1 -i, --interactive2.2.2 -t, --tty2.2.3 -d, --detach2.2.4 -e, --env2.2.5 -u, --user2.2.6 -w, --workdir3 典型使用场景与示例3.1 进入容器交互式

Docker多容器编排:Compose 实战教程

文章目录 概念简述 配置文件格式 参数详解 docker compose指令 综合案例 概念简述核心定义  Docker Compose 是一个用于定义和运行多容器 Docker 应用程序的工具。它允许您使用一个单独的配置文件(通常是 .yml 格式)来配置应用程序的所有服务、网络和卷,然后通过一条简单的命令就能创建和启动所有服务。 可以把它想

Docker--Docker网络原理

虚拟网卡==虚拟网卡(Virtual Network Interface,简称vNIC) 是一种在软件层面模拟的网卡设备,不依赖于物理硬件,而是通过操作系统或虚拟化技术实现网络通信功能。==它允许计算机在虚拟环境中模拟物理网卡的行为,用于连接虚拟网络或与物理网络交互。 核心特点1.

【Docker】docker 安装 nginx

目录 前言 一、Docker 安装和部署 Nginx 1.1 拉取镜像 1.2 获取 nginx 的配置文件 1.2.1 创建目录 1.2.2 启动nginx 1.2.3 拷贝相关的nginx文件 1.2.4 关闭容器,移除容器 1.3 运行 1.4 访问测试 二、Docker Compose 安装和部署 Nginx 2.1 拉取镜像 2

Jenkins 详解与实战:从安装到部署,打造你的自动化流水线

一、什么是 Jenkins?Jenkins 是一个开源的持续集成和持续交付(CI/CD)工具,广泛用于软件开发中的自动化构建、测试和部署流程。它支持数百个插件,几乎可以与所有技术栈无缝集成,是 DevOps 流程中不可或缺的一环。核心功能: 功能 描述 持续集成(CI&#

Docker Desktop 安装与使用详解

目录 1. 前言 2. Docker Desktop 安装 2.1 下载及安装 2.2 登录 Docker 账号 2.3 进入 Docker Desktop 主界面 3. Docker 版本查看与环境检查 3.1 查看 Docker Desktop 支持的 Docker 和 Kubernetes 版本 3.2 检查 Docker 版本 4. Docker H

CodeBuddy三大利器:Craft智能体、MCP协议和DeepSeek V3,编程效率提升的秘诀:我的CodeBuddy升级体验之旅(个性化推荐微服务系统)

 🌟 嗨,我是Lethehong!🌟 🌍 立志在坚不欲说,成功在久不在速🌍 🚀 欢迎关注:👍点赞⬆️留言收藏🚀 🍀欢迎使用:小智初学计算机网页IT深度知识智能体 &#x1f680

干货含源码!如何用Java后端操作Docker(命令行篇)

目录干货含源码!如何用Java后端操作Docker(命令行篇)一、为什么要用后端程序操作Docker二、安装Docker1、安装Docker2、启动Docker三、使用Java后端操作docker1、构建docker镜像并生成容器2、执行完毕后删除容器和镜像3、在此基础上开发其他功能四、总结 作者:watermelo37 涉及领域&#

小白如何使用Docker本地部署GitHub项目?

目录 步骤1:阅读README.md 步骤2:安装 Docker 步骤3:准备配置文件 步骤4:启动服务 步骤5:访问应用 步骤1:阅读README.md 下载项目代码(可通过 GitHub 下载 ZIP 包解压) 仔细查看本地应用的访问地址 步